Liquid Assets in 2019: A Review



Looking back at the year 2019, businesses across numerous industries demonstrated varied approaches to managing cash reserves. Generally, a cautious stance prevailed, influenced by heightening economic instability globally. While some firms prioritized growth and leveraged their available funds for takeovers, others opted to strengthen their financial cushions anticipating a potential downturn. The average quantity of working capital remained relatively consistent compared to the prior period, though there was a noticeable divergence between high-growth and more established entities. This review highlights the necessity of maintaining a adequate financial reserve for navigating unforeseen obstacles and taking advantage of unexpected prospects.


2019 Funds Operational Strategies



As the year drew to a close, businesses were increasingly focused on fine-tuning their working capital position. Several key tactics emerged as particularly effective. These included a increased emphasis on accurate projection – moving beyond traditional, static models to embrace technology that could respond to fluctuations in earnings and expenses. Furthermore, many firms explored expediting payments through better invoicing systems and arranging more advantageous conditions with creditors. Finally, a growing number prioritized unified banking arrangements to gain improved terms and insight into international cash movements. These combined efforts contributed to boost total financial security.
